"The magnetic, structural, elastic and electronic properties of Sm-chalcogenides in the stable Fm (3) over barm and high pressure Pm (3) over barm phase have been analyzed using an ab initio pseudo-potential method with a spin-polarized GGA based on exchange-correlation energy optimization, as implemented in SIESTA code. The magnetic phase stability has been determined from the total energy calculations in non-magnetic and magnetic phases, which clearly indicate that at ambient and high pressures, these compounds are ferromagnetically stable," scientists in Gwalior, India report.
